For those of you in the US who happen to get the National Geographic channel on your TV, "Lake Tanganyika: Jewel of the Rift" will be airing on 26 Feb 03.

This video shows live footage of Synodontis multipunctatus spawning with mouth brooding cîchlids. Worth seeing if you happen to have Lake Tanganyika fish.
